    Brooklyn Beckham and Nicola Peltz Raise $59,000 for Dogs Displaced by LA Wildfires

    Brooklyn Beckham and his wife, Nicola Peltz Beckham, have reportedly raised nearly $59,000 to help dogs displaced by the Los Angeles wildfires, following claims that Brooklyn’s mother, Victoria Beckham, declined to support their charity efforts.

    The update comes shortly after Brooklyn shared an emotional Instagram statement about his strained relationship with his parents, Victoria and David Beckham. Brooklyn said the only time he and Nicola asked his parents for help was during the LA fires, when Nicola sought support to rescue displaced dogs. He says this request was refused.

    According to reports, Nicola raised the funds independently through her charity, Yogi’s House, which rescues dogs from overcrowded shelters and prevents euthanasia. A GoFundMe campaign linked to the effort raised $59,444, helping relocate animals from fire-affected areas into safe foster homes.

    The wildfires that struck Los Angeles in January 2025 claimed 31 lives, forced over 200,000 people to evacuate, and destroyed more than 18,000 structures. While many organisations focused on human relief, Nicola concentrated on animals left behind, organising fundraising events and sharing updates on social media.

    Despite being the son of one of the world’s most famous couples and Nicola being the daughter of billionaire Nelson Peltz, reports claim that Brooklyn personally donated $5,000 to the cause. The couple also shared photos and live updates from a fundraising event at the Pendry Hotel in West Hollywood, where brands donated supplies for those affected by the fires.

    Victoria Beckham had previously posted about the wildfires on Instagram, calling the situation “heartbreaking” and expressing gratitude to firefighters and first responders. David Beckham also shared messages of support and urged people to help organisations working on the ground.

    Brooklyn’s recent statement, however, suggests that tensions within the family run much deeper. He accused his parents of prioritising public image over personal relationships and said he has no intention of reconciling at this time. He claimed that stepping away from his family has brought him peace after years of anxiety.

    He also repeated earlier allegations, including claims that Victoria backed out of designing Nicola’s wedding dress at the last moment and interfered during their wedding celebrations — incidents that, according to Brooklyn, caused lasting embarrassment and emotional strain.

    The Beckham family has not officially responded to the latest claims. Sources close to them have previously said that David and Victoria want to repair the relationship and have asked Brooklyn and Nicola to talk, but reconciliation appears uncertain for now.

    As public attention continues to focus on the family rift, Brooklyn and Nicola’s fundraising efforts for displaced animals have drawn support and praise, highlighting their commitment to animal welfare even amid personal turmoil.
